[ Summary ] Examination of the relationship between membrane surface structures and protein affinity is necessary to evaluate biocompatibility. Recently, material surface analysis technology operating at nanoscale level has significantly improved. As a result, it has been revealed that uniform surfaces determined with conventional methods are incorrect when determined with nanoscale evaluation. It is possible that nanoscale irregularities may affect the biocompatibility of membranes. Nanoscale control is important to design and develop dialysis membranes which will deliver high performance and high functionality.
